Holistic Review and the Personal Touch FSU employs a holistic review process, meaning the evaluation extends far beyond grades and test scores. The perceived difficulty hinges largely on how an applicant's academic profile compares to the middle 50% of the previously enrolled freshman class.
Middle 50% score ranges for the admitted class generally fall between 1300-1450 for the SAT, demonstrating that successful applicants typically perform well on these assessments. This comprehensive look allows applicants with unique stories or special talents to distinguish themselves, even if their academic metrics are slightly below the average.
